The Sr. Center Coordinator is responsible for efficient patient flow, superior customer service, attaining monthly goals/ performance indicators, data entry, schedule and treatment plan management, and patient retention.
  • Ensure compliance in all assigned centers that all patient charts are up to date, HIPAA compliant, proper input of demographics, procedures, payments into the database
  • Review scheduling and financial responsibilities and referrals with each patient throughout care.
  • Send precertification forms at the close of business daily to the Precertification Department to account for all patients that require authorization prior to services being rendered
  • Ensure centers are compliant with the collection and data input for one-month surveys
  • Ensure that the Surgical Assistant completes the inventory count daily and uploads it to the team site
  • Confirm that assigned centers perform/complete the Daily Close correctly at the close of business each night

Minimum Requirements: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ent required; Associates Degree preferred
  • Minimum of 1 year in administrative experience, preferably in a medical office
  • Must have reliable transportation to clinics that may not be accessible to public transportation
  • Spanish fluency REQUIRED
